Ingredients
Ingredients
Main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ked rice
- 1/2 cup chopped vegetables (carrots, cucumber, etc.)
- 1/4 cup sesame seeds
- 1/4 cup nori (seaweed) sheets
- Soy sauce for serving
Optional Fillings
- Tuna or salmon
- Pickled vegetables
- Avocado slices
Feel free to customize your rice balls with your favorite ingredients!
Instructions
Instructions
Prepare the Rice
Begin by cooking the rice according to package instructions. Let it cool slightly before handling.
Mix Ingredients
In a large bowl, combine the cooked rice with chopped vegetables and sesame seeds. If using optional fillings, mix them in as well.
Shape the Rice Balls
Wet your hands and take a portion of the rice mixture. Shape it into a ball, pressing firmly to hold its shape. Repeat until all rice is used.
Wrap with Nori
Cut the nori sheets into strips. Wrap each rice ball with a strip of nori for added flavor and presentation.
Serve
Serve the rice balls with soy sauce on the side for dipping. Enjoy your healthy and delicious snack!
These rice balls can be eaten immediately or stored in the fridge for later use.

Storage and Reheating Tips
Storing Korean Rice Balls is simple and ensures they stay fresh for your next meal. Once they’ve cooled completely, place them in an airtight container in the refrigerator. They’ll generally last for up to three days. If you're looking to keep them for an extended period, consider freezing them. Just make sure to wrap individual rice balls tightly before placing them in a freezer-safe bag.
When it comes to reheating, you can enjoy them cold, but if you prefer, a quick zap in the microwave for about 20-30 seconds is perfect. If they’ve been frozen, ensure they are thawed adequately before reheating. This makes them a hassle-free option for busy days, keeping your lunch routine both easy and delicious.
